<DIV> I bought and resold a hammond piano about a year ago. It tuned nicely and it was very well built. The cabinet finish was in great shape. It was a spinet without front legs. The cabinet made the piano look like an electric organ. It was interesting that Hammond would keep that organ look for their pianos. </DIV>
